How to make junctions easier.

One of the things that trips up many learner drivers is feeling rushed at junctions, pulling up, stopping, then fumbling to find the biting point while trying to look for a gap. But junctions don’t have to feel like that.

The key is to approach slowly and be ready to either stop or go.

This technique reduces the pressure at junctions and makes emerging feel far more natural. You’re not reacting to traffic, you’re anticipating it.
